NEWMARKET — Dr. Thomas J. Carroll Jr., superintendent of the Oyster River Cooperative School District, 58, of Wade Farm, died suddenly March 20, 2005, at his home in Newmarket.

Born June 14, 1946, in Canaan, Conn., he was the son of Thomas J. and Cecelia (Pozzetta) Carroll. Raised in Canaan, he had lived in Litchfield for 18 years before moving to Newmarket nine years ago.

He received his BA from Merrimack College, his MMT from the University of Lowell and his PhD. from the University of New Hampshire in 1996.

Dr. Carroll has been the superintendent of the Oyster River Cooperative School District for the past nine years. He deservedly earned the respect and admiration of students, faculty, community, School Board members and colleagues.

In the local community he served on the following boards: the Oyster River Community for Healthy Youth, the Southern Strafford Community Health Coalition, and Seacoast Educational Services. He was a member of the University of N.H. Center for Mathematics, Science and Engineering.

He provided state leadership with the Department of Education via the AYP Advisory Committee, the School Improvement Advisory Committee and the ESEA Task Force. He was also a member of the following regional and national groups: N.H. School Administrators Association Board of Directors, was one of two N.H. School Administrator representatives to the American Association of School Administrators (AASA) Governing Board, AASA Membership and Service Advisory Committee, Education Law Association and the National Council of Teachers of Mathematics.

He was an avid N.Y. Yankees Fan!!!

He was predeceased by his parents and his son, Michael W. Carroll, who died Aug. 15, 1999.

He is survived by his wife, Kathleen (Sweeney) Carroll, of Newmarket; three children, Thomas J. Carroll III of Newmarket, Kacey Carroll of Boston and Tina Carroll of Boston; a sister, Linda Walsh of Lexington, Mass.; two nephews; one niece, and many cousins, colleagues and friends.
